Delete the restored Windows offline access account from Duo Mobile before reactivating Windows offline access. Reactivation of Windows offline access creates a second offline access account. Duo for Windows offline access does not reactivate offline access accounts restored to your phone.Be sure to delete those accounts from Duo Mobile on the old device or delete Duo Mobile entirely from the old device once you verify the passcodes generated by the restored accounts work for logging in to those services. Restoring any third-party accounts on the new device does not deactivate those accounts on the old device.Restoring or reactivating any "Duo-Protected" and "Duo Admin" accounts on the new device deactivates those accounts on the old device.When you use the below methods to restore Duo accounts on a new or replacement device, be aware that: You may need to log in.Duo Mobile's restore functionality lets you back up Duo-protected accounts and third-party OTP accounts (such as Google or Facebook) for recovery to the same device or to a new device. Head to the Security tab of your account page.If you think someone else might have access to your backup codes, you can generate new ones. If you’re using a shared computer, don’t download your backup codes.Save your backup codes in a secure place.We show you your backup codes when you turn on 2-step verification, and you can also find them on your account page under password protection. If you lose your phone or can't access your authenticator app, you can use a backup code to log in. Be sure to delete all downloaded backup codes if you’ve turned off 2-step verification. ![]() ![]() Note: We strongly recommend using 2-step verification for increased account protection. You’ll receive an email confirmation after you make any changes to your 2-step verification setup. You’ll need to log in again before confirming any changes. Hit Change to set up a new device, phone number, or authenticator app, or Remove to turn off 2-step verification. Select Security then Edit under 2-step verification. You can set up a new device, update your phone number, change your authenticator app, or turn off 2-step verification on your account page. If you see the error message "Too many attempts, please try again later", you'll need to wait 30 minutes before trying again. If you can’t access the code sent via text message or generated by your authenticator app, select Want to log in another way? and try using one of your backup codes to log in. Trouble logging in with 2-step verification? You’ll be asked for a code every time you log in to Spotify for Artists or other Spotify web pages. Select Want to log in another way? to switch to your authenticator app or use a backup code instead. If you’ve enabled both text message and an authenticator app, we’ll send your code as a text message by default.
